Finding the Galveston Police Department

When locating the Galveston Police Department, it's essential to have the exact address to avoid any confusion. The Galveston Police Department is situated at 601 54th St, Galveston, TX 77551. This address is easily accessible and well-known in the city. Whether you're driving, taking public transportation, or using a ride-sharing service, inputting this address into your navigation system will guide you directly to the department. Contacting the Galveston Police Department

Need to get in touch with the Galveston Police Department? Knowing the various contact methods is super important. For general inquiries, you can call their non-emergency line. This is the number to use when you need assistance that isn't an immediate emergency. The non-emergency number is readily available on the Galveston city website and other official sources. Keeping this number handy can save you valuable time when you need to report a non-urgent issue or seek information.

In case of an emergency, always dial 911. This is the quickest way to get immediate assistance from the police, fire department, or ambulance services. Knowing when to call 911 is crucial; it should only be used for situations where there is an immediate threat to life or property. Examples include a crime in progress, a fire, or a serious medical emergency. Using 911 appropriately ensures that emergency services can respond promptly and effectively to those who need them most.
